    Still don’t know how to center a div after multiple classes using HTML

    • @otesunki
      @otesunki 3 года назад +55

      container {
      display: flex;
      align-items: center;
      justify-content: center;
      }
      or if your browser SUCKS:
      content {
      position: absolute;
      left: 50%;
      top: 50%;
      transform: translate(-50%, -50%);
      }

    • @sherry2480
      @sherry2480 3 года назад +3

      in the parent container (flex-direction is default/column),
      set justify-content to center: components inside the container are centered vertically in the container
      set align-items to center: components inside the container are centered horizontally in the container
      but if the container has flex-direction set to row,
      set align-items to center: components inside container are centered vertically in the container
      set justify-content to center: components inside container are centered horizontally in the container
